Pushya Nakshatra

General Characteristics: In control of passions, well liked, learned in various subjects, rich and fond of doing charitable acts. 

Translation: To provide nourishment. 
Symbol: The udder of a cow, flower, a circle, an arrow. 

Animal symbol: A ram. 
Ruling planet: Saturn. 
Nature: Deva (god-like) 
Presiding deity: Brihaspati, the planet Jupiter, lord of sacred speech and prayer. 

Positive Traits: Hard working, creative, tolerant of pain, intelligent, learned, liked by many, spiritual, intuitive wisdom, helps others, make good advisors and public servants, independent, interested in education and humanitarian causes, philanthropic, socially adept, make people feel wanted, selfless, good finances, respected, moderate, have spiritual practice, passionate and defensive about the things they believe in. 

Negative Traits: Stubborn, selfish, arrogant, overly talkative, dogmatic, fundamentalist, overly sensitive, doubtful of their worth due to what others say about them, devotion can turn to victimization, get defrauded by believing in the wrong people, insecurities inhibit growth. 

Career Interests: Government, politics, geologist, aquatic biologist, military police, musicians, artists, rulers, ministers, managing directors, food merchants, clergy, priests.
